Post Depth by Climate
Posts need 2ft minimum depth, or below frost line (36-48" in northern states). AI checks your region's frost depth for stable post settings.
Hardware Longevity Guide
Galvanized hardware lasts 15-20 years. Vinyl-coated: 20-25. Stainless steel: 25+. AI recommends based on coastal proximity and humidity.
Setback & Permit Check
Most municipalities require fences 2-8" inside property lines. AI reminds you to verify local codes and HOA rules before ordering materials.
Calculation Formula
Posts = (Length / Spacing) + 1
Top rail = Length
Fabric = Length + 6" per terminal post
Fence Material Comparison
| Material | Cost/Linear Ft | Lifespan | Maintenance | Post Spacing |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Wood Privacy | $15-30 | 15-20 years | Annual staining | 6-8 ft |
| Chain Link | $8-18 | 20-30 years | Minimal | 8-10 ft |
| Vinyl | $20-40 | 25-40 years | Wash occasionally | 6-8 ft |
| Aluminum/Steel | $25-50 | 30-50+ years | Minimal | 6-8 ft |
| Composite | $25-45 | 25-40 years | Minimal | 6-8 ft |

Frequently Asked Questions
How much does chain link fence cost?
$8-$20 per linear foot installed (4ft height). A 100ft fence costs $800-$3,000.
How far apart should chain link posts be?
Standard spacing is 10 ft on center for residential chain link.
